This anthology presents thirty-one short stories by Central American writers from Guatemala, Panama, Costa Rica, Nicaragua, Honduras, and El Salvador, edited by Barbara Paschke and David Volpendesta, featuring voices ranging from Carmen Lyra and Nobel Prize-winner Miguel Angel Asturias to contemporary authors, offering perspectives on war, history, culture, and the passionate lives of Central Americans during a turbulent era.
